To play PC games with a controller, connect the controller via USB or Bluetooth. Most modern controllers such as Xbox or PlayStation controllers are plug-and-play with Windows. You may need to install driver software if not automatically recognized. Launch your game, enter Settings > Controller to configure it as desired.

FAQs & Answers

  1. Can I use any controller to play PC games? Yes, most modern controllers like Xbox and PlayStation controllers are compatible with PC. They typically use plug-and-play functionality.
  2. Do I need to install drivers for my controller? In most cases, no. Modern controllers are usually recognized automatically by Windows. However, if your controller isn't recognized, you may need to download driver software from the manufacturer's website.
  3. How do I configure my controller for a specific game? To configure your controller, launch the game, go to Settings, and select Controller options to customize the controls as per your preference.
  4. Can I play PC games with a wireless controller? Yes, you can connect a wireless controller to your PC via Bluetooth. Make sure your PC has Bluetooth capability and that the controller is in pairing mode.
